Water Valley, Texas is a small rural town located in the western part of the state. With a population of just over 1,000 residents, it offers a quiet and tight-knit community for those looking for a slower pace of life. The town is known for its strong sense of community and family values, as well as its close proximity to larger cities like San Angelo and Abilene.
